    If you’re fascinated by movement, energy and the physical world, delve into the world of physics and set yourself up to solve problems across a range of industries.  

    Learn about mechanics and waves, quantum theory, electromagnetism, thermodynamics, the physics of materials and applications of nanotechnology. This knowledge will allow you to solve problems across industries, from applying physics to human movement and medicine, to improving defence capabilities, to understanding nanostructures that can improve the materials we use.

    You’ll develop advanced skills in applied mathematics and chemistry, and a range of problem-solving and analytical skills that are in high demand with employers.

    What you’ll learn

    Build the knowledge and skills you need to meet your career or study goals. Here are some of the things you’ll learn:

    • experimental physics and nanotechnology
    • electromagnetism
    • physics of materials
    • energy, mass and flow
    • applications of nanotechnology.

    Professional recognition

    This degree has been accredited by the Australian Institute of Physics. When you graduate, you can apply to the Academic Chair to become a member of the Australian Institute of Physics and the Institute of Physics in the UK.
